When is the best time of year to stay in a hostel in Bolquere?
Good weather's always better when you're discovering new places, so here's a little information that may be helpful: The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 59°F, while the coldest months are February and January with an average of 33°F. Average annual precipitation for Bolquere is 50 inches.
What is there to see and do in Bolquere?
In general, Bolquere is known for its: skiing and mountain views. Get out into nature with places like Lac de Matemale, Lac des Bouillouses, and Dorres Roman Baths. Cultural attractions include Mont-Louis Solar Furnace and Llívia Municipal Museum. Locals like to shop at Santa Maria Plaza.
What's the best way to get to and around Bolquere while staying at a hostel?
Keep this information about transit options in and around Bolquere on hand to make the most of your stay: You can search for flights to the nearest airport, which is Perpignan (PGF-Perpignan - Rivesaltes Intl.), located 43.4 mi (69.9 km) away from the city center. Once you've arrived, you may want to use public transit during your trip. If you're eager to see more of the surrounding area, make your way to Bolquère-Eyne Station to take a train.
